Fares Awad sparks controversy with Morocco frog remark

Smiling man in traditional Emirati attire sits at a desk with a smartphone, surrounded by a vibrant red and blue studio backdrop.

Emirati commentator Fares Awad has stirred controversy after using a striking metaphor to describe Morocco’s recent performance, saying: “Morocco tried to pull the frog out of the swamp.”

Awad’s remark quickly spread across social media, drawing mixed reactions from fans. While some viewed it as sharp football commentary in his usual style, others considered the phrase inappropriate and disrespectful toward the Moroccan team.

The comment came as Awad was discussing Morocco’s match, using the expression to suggest the team was trying hard to fix a difficult situation and change the course of the game.

The phrase became the center of a wider debate online, with many users calling for more careful language on air, while others defended the commentator’s right to describe matches in a bold and direct way.
